Doctors don’t need contract distractions during pandemic


By Letter to the Editor on April 7, 2020.

Minister Shandro,

I heard with dismay and distress your comments about physician pay being rolled out now. You must not be aware we are in the midst of a pandemic!

Doctors need no distractions; you should be thanking them every day for their efforts.

Start playing nice with others, particularly those who hold our lives in their control. The huge effort they are putting in should be praised; they do not need the distraction of a bully.

Please back off this lunacy of contract talks, and let them do the critical job they are doing. Lead and support, not distract.
